A Vision Of The Avenging Sword Of Yahweh

24 “Therefore, this is what the Lord God says: Because you have drawn attention to your guilt, exposing your transgressions, so that your sins are revealed in all your actions, since you have done this, you will be captured by them. 25 And you, profane and wicked prince of Israel,
the day has come
for your punishment.”
26 This is what the Lord God says:

Remove the turban, and take off the crown.
Things will not remain as they are;
exalt the lowly and bring down the exalted.
